# HG changeset patch # User arpi # Date 1028048041 0 # Node ID 9acac87c7bfb4edebe69be61268520f0c6d438d6 # Parent e69615f1c309c0ed4d7ba0b34747f51a507b53df updated - feel free to comment diff -r e69615f1c309 -r 9acac87c7bfb DOCS/tech/TODO --- a/DOCS/tech/TODO Tue Jul 30 16:41:33 2002 +0000 +++ b/DOCS/tech/TODO Tue Jul 30 16:54:01 2002 +0000 @@ -2,15 +2,28 @@ TODO: ===== -FOR THE PRE-RELEASE: -~~~~~~~~~~~~~~~~~~~~ -- finish mencoder -ovc vfw (bitrate setting, codec selection etc) -- codec priority option +FOR THE v0.90 RELEASE: +~~~~~~~~~~~~~~~~~~~~~~ +- use codec family names instead of IDs (-afm/-vfm changes) +- codec (vc/ac) priority option +- ao/vo priority option +demuxer: +- fix .asf demuxer bugs - DONE? +- fix buggy .rm files (broken rv20/30 frames) - Florian? +- add+test non-cook realaudio codecs - samples? +- fix .mp4 demuxer bugs - Atmos? (sig11, bad AAC audio) -FOR THE RELEASE: -~~~~~~~~~~~~~~~~ -- mencoder: migrate to muxer layer +FOR THE v1.00 RELEASE: +~~~~~~~~~~~~~~~~~~~~~~ + +- audio filter layer +- new demuxer layer - at least modularized... +- display OSD and subtitles using DVB card's OSD + +mpg demuxer: +- implement mpeg-TS demuxer +- implement common mpeg 1/2/4 es/ps/pes/mp3 demuxer avi demuxer: (needs rewrite) - fix AVI index offset base position handling ('no video stream found' bug) @@ -19,37 +32,31 @@ - fix for growing avi files (movi_end pos > stream->end_pos) - implement forward seeking in avi streams with no index -demuxer: -- fix .asf demuxer bugs -- forward seeking from stdin ? -- fix the whole syncing mechanism of Real demuxer -- implement mpeg-TS demuxer +mencoder: +- finish mencoder -ovc vfw (bitrate setting, codec selection etc) +- implement muxer layer (for mpg, ogm, mov support) +- add ogg/vorbis audio encoder +- stop/resume + +docs: +- migrate to XML/DocBook +- restructuring? FUTURE: ~~~~~~~ -decoders: -- fix DLLs: pegasusm, pegasusl, pegasusmwv, 3ivX, morgands, alaris, vcr1, pim1, - qpeg, rricm - demuxer: - demux_mpg: support for VDR's index files for more accurate seeking - implement seeking for YUV4MPEG_2_ decoders: -- qtx support? +- fix DLLs: pegasusm, pegasusl, pegasusmwv, 3ivX, morgands, alaris, vcr1, pim1, + qpeg, rricm -mencoder: -- add ogg/vorbis audio encoder -- stop/resume - -gui: -- playlist ? -- preferences ? +decoders: +- qtx support? other: - dvd server - mga_vid crtc2 fix - make nvidia_vid ;) -- display OSD and subtitles using DVB card's OSD -- sync with mplayerxp-vidix (pm3 and rage128)